
要在Excel表格中打乱电话号码,可以使用随机排序、RANDBETWEEN函数、辅助列的方式。其中,随机排序是最常用且简便的方法。下面将详细介绍如何在Excel中实现电话号码的打乱,包括使用随机排序和辅助列的方法。
一、使用随机排序法
随机排序法是Excel中最直接、最简单的方法,通过对数据添加随机数列然后进行排序,从而打乱电话号码。
1. 添加随机数列
首先,在电话号码的旁边添加一列随机数。可以在一个空白列中输入公式 =RAND(),然后将该公式向下拖动,以此为每一个电话号码生成一个随机数。
2. 复制随机数列
为了避免在排序后随机数重新计算,建议将生成的随机数列复制并粘贴为数值。选择所有生成的随机数,右键单击选择“复制”,然后右键单击目标区域选择“选择性粘贴”,并选择“数值”。
3. 按随机数列排序
选中所有数据,包括电话号码和随机数列,点击“数据”选项卡中的“排序”,选择按照随机数列进行排序。这样,电话号码就会被打乱了。
二、使用辅助列和RANDBETWEEN函数
辅助列和RANDBETWEEN函数可以通过生成随机数索引来实现电话号码的打乱。
1. 生成随机索引
在一个空白列中,使用公式 =RANDBETWEEN(1, ROWS(A:A)),其中 A:A 是电话号码所在的列。这个公式会在1到电话号码数量的范围内生成随机索引。
2. 排序随机索引
将生成的随机索引列复制并粘贴为数值,如同之前的步骤。然后按照这些随机索引排序。
3. 重新排列电话号码
创建一个新的电话号码列,按照随机索引的顺序重新排列原来的电话号码。
三、具体操作步骤详解
1. 准备工作
首先,准备好一个包含电话号码的Excel表格。假设电话号码在A列,从A2开始。
2. 添加随机数列
在B2单元格中输入公式 =RAND(),然后将该公式向下拖动到所有电话号码旁边。每个电话号码旁边都会生成一个随机数。
3. 复制随机数列为数值
选中生成的随机数列,右键单击选择“复制”,然后右键单击目标区域选择“选择性粘贴”,并选择“数值”。
4. 按随机数列排序
选中A列和B列所有数据,点击“数据”选项卡中的“排序”,按照B列排序。电话号码被打乱。
5. 使用辅助列和RANDBETWEEN函数
在C列中输入公式 =RANDBETWEEN(1, ROWS(A:A)),生成随机索引。然后复制并粘贴为数值,按照C列排序。在新的一列中,使用索引重新排列电话号码。
四、注意事项
1. 数据备份
在进行数据打乱之前,建议对原始数据进行备份,以防数据丢失或操作错误。
2. 随机数重新计算
在使用=RAND()函数生成随机数时,每次表格刷新都会重新计算随机数。因此,复制并粘贴为数值是避免随机数重新计算的关键步骤。
3. 数据完整性
在打乱电话号码后,确保所有数据的完整性,没有遗漏或重复。可以通过数据验证工具检查数据的唯一性和完整性。
4. 公式灵活性
根据实际情况,可以调整公式和方法。例如,使用其他随机函数或排序方法,以满足特定需求。
五、常见问题解答
1. 为什么要复制随机数列为数值?
在Excel中,=RAND()函数会在每次计算时生成新的随机数。如果不将随机数列复制为数值,排序后随机数会重新计算,导致无法正确打乱电话号码。
2. 如何确保数据不重复?
使用RANDBETWEEN函数生成随机索引时,可能会出现重复索引。可以通过数据验证工具检查重复值,并手动调整重复索引,确保数据的唯一性。
3. 能否使用VBA实现电话号码打乱?
可以使用VBA编写脚本,实现电话号码的打乱。VBA方法更加灵活,可以自定义排序规则和数据处理逻辑。
六、案例分析
案例一:客户电话号码打乱
某公司需要对客户电话号码进行打乱,以进行随机抽样调查。通过上述方法,生成随机数列并排序,快速实现电话号码的打乱,确保抽样的随机性和公平性。
案例二:数据隐私保护
在数据分析过程中,出于隐私保护的需要,需要对电话号码进行打乱。通过添加随机数列排序,快速实现电话号码的打乱,有效保护客户隐私。
通过以上详细步骤和方法介绍,相信你已经掌握了如何在Excel表格中打乱电话号码。这不仅可以用于数据分析、抽样调查等场景,还能在数据处理和隐私保护中发挥重要作用。希望这些方法和技巧能够帮助你更好地处理Excel数据,提高工作效率。
相关问答FAQs:
1. 如何在Excel表格中随机打乱电话号码的顺序?
- 首先,选择你想要打乱电话号码的列。
- 然后,点击Excel菜单栏中的“数据”选项卡。
- 接下来,找到“排序和筛选”功能,点击下拉菜单中的“随机排序”选项。
- 最后,确认选择并点击“确定”按钮,电话号码将会被随机打乱。
2. 我怎样在Excel表格中对电话号码进行随机排列?
- 首先,确保你已经将电话号码放置在一个单独的列中。
- 然后,选中该列并点击Excel菜单栏中的“数据”选项卡。
- 接下来,点击“排序和筛选”功能,选择“随机排序”选项。
- 最后,确认选择并点击“确定”按钮,电话号码将会被随机排列。
3. 我想在Excel表格中对电话号码进行乱序排列,应该怎么做?
- 首先,选中你想要乱序排列的电话号码所在的列。
- 然后,点击Excel菜单栏中的“数据”选项卡。
- 接下来,点击“排序和筛选”功能,选择“随机排序”选项。
- 最后,确认选择并点击“确定”按钮,电话号码将会被乱序排列。
注意:在使用随机排序功能时,请确保你已经备份了原始数据,以防止数据的不可逆改变。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4971592